What Is Hydraulic Bridge?

The hydraulic bridge also known as “moving bridge” is a bridge that is used to allow seaside traffic through a body of water. In short, it can be moved to allow the passage for boats or ships. The bridge design incorporates an integrated hydraulic system into the bridge in order to carry more weight.

How does a hydraulic work?

Hydraulic fluid creates fluid power by pumping the fluid through the hydraulic system. The fluid flows to the cylinder through the valve, and the hydraulic energy converts it back to mechanical energy. The valves aid to direct the flow of the fluid and the pressure can be relieved if needed.

What is hydraulic and its types?

Open loop hydraulic system and closed loop hydraulic system are the two types of hydraulic system. In an open loop system, when the actuating mechanism is idle, there will be fluid flow but no pressure. For a closed loop system, when the pump operates there will be pressure for fluids.

Where is the first hydraulic bridge?

The oldest know movable bridge was built in the 2nd millennium BC in the ancient Egypt. History also knows for one early movable bridge built in Chaldea in the Middle East in 6th century BC.

What mean hydraulic?

Hydraulics is a mechanical function that operates through the force of liquid pressure. In hydraulics-based systems, mechanical movement is produced by contained, pumped liquid, typically through hydraulic cylinders moving pistons.

What is the main use of hydraulic?

The major function of a hydraulic fluid is to provide energy transmission through the system which enables work and motion to be accomplished. Hydraulic fluids are also responsible for lubrication, heat transfer and contamination control.

Why is hydraulic used?

Hydraulic systems are capable of moving heavier loads as well as providing greater force than mechanical, electrical or pneumatic systems. The fluid power system means it can easily cope with a large weight range without having to use gears, pulleys or heavy leavers.

What are the 4 types of hydraulic fluid?

There are three basic types of hydraulic fluid: water-based, petroleum-based, and synthetic. Each type has its own special characteristics that make it ideal for certain applications. In addition, there are some fluids that are preferred for applications that can affect the environment.

What materials are used in hydraulics?

Materials used in hydraulic equipment include a wide assortment of metals and synthetics. Titanium is used in the extremely high-pressure systems, some of which perform at more than 50,000 pounds per square inch (psi). Other materials include numerous steel and stainless steel alloys, brass, woven wire and rubber.

Why is it called hydraulic?

The word “hydraulics” originates from the Greek word ὑδραυλικός (hydraulikos) which in turn originates from ὕδωρ (hydor, Greek for water) and αὐλός (aulos, meaning pipe).

What is basic hydraulic system?

The simplest hydraulic circuit consists of a reservoir, pump, relief valve, 3-way directional control valve, single acting cylinder, connectors and lines. This system is used where the cylinder piston is returned by mechanical force.
